Low-Income Energy Assistance (LEAP) Available for the Winter Season
Image:Low-Income Energy Assistance (LEAP) Available for the Winter Season Durango, CO – The La Plata County Department of Human Services is again partnering with Discover Goodwill of Southern + Western Colorado to administer the Low-Income Energy Assistance (LEAP) Program. This is a federally funded program which assists low-income households with utility costs for their main heating source. To qualify, applicants must be...

Third Quarter Passenger Traffic Continues To Set Records
Image:Third Quarter Passenger Traffic Continues To Set Records Durango, CO – Airline passenger traffic at the Durango-La Plata County Airport continues its record growth. Passenger traffic set monthly records every month during the third quarter rising a total of 8% for the quarter. 137,967 passengers have boarded commercial airlines through the end of September, 2012, a year-to-year increase of 4.8%. “We expect this trend...
